Gold is measured in Troy ounces and 1 Troy ounce equals 1.0971428571 ounces. 1 metric tonne = 32,150.746 Troy ounces 1 long ton of 2240 lb (UK) = 32,666.667 Troy ounces 1 short ton of 2000lb (US) = 29,166.667 Troy ounces

A pound of gold weighs 14.583 troy ounces. This answer is correct only if you mean an avoirdupois pound. A troy pound (used for precious metals) is 12 troy ounces. If you ask how many troy ounces are in a pound, you would normally mean a troy pound unless you specify another type of measure - there are several different difinitions for the measure "pound".

When buying gold, it is measured in ounces. There are 31.103 grams in each ounce of gold. A 1 oz gold coin would therefore weigh 31.103 grams which is different from the regular conversion of grams to ounces.
One gram = 0.032151 troy ounces

22k is a measure of purity, not quantity. So you can get one millionth of an ounce or a million ounces of 22k gold.
